Christiane Heibach (Erfurt),

born 1967, studied German Literature, History and Philosophy in Bamberg, Paris and Heidelberg. She is assistant professor at the Department of Comparative Literary Studies and Media at the University of Erfurt. She wrote her PhD-thesis on literature in the internet and has published articles on media theory and the aesthetics of digital and net-literature. She is currently working on several projects concerning the historical roots of net-literature.
